Afternoon 😊 I hope you are all well in what is a very difficult time.
I am for the moment continuing to work as usual, obviously this is open to change according to government guidelines. I have however made the decision following the latest BHS statement to stop, for the time being, conducting jump lessons. We all know that handling and riding horses in any capacity carries it's own risk, however at a time when the NHS and it's staff are under immense pressure I feel that any unnecessary increase in risk would be irresponsible on my part.
On the plus side we all know that good flatwork is the foundation of successful jumping so by the time this is over you will all have beautifully balanced, supple and responsive horses!!!

Good evening all 😊 just a quick note regarding cancellations. I have always and will continue to be fair when emergencies crop up which make going ahead with a planned lesson impossible. However, when a lesson is booked I plan my time around that so to be cancelled on the day means a loss of income as I do not have time to fill the space. All lessons cancelled on the day, other than in the case of an emergency, incur a charge of the full price of the lesson to be paid either via bank transfer or on the day of the next lesson booked. In the event of the horse being unable to continue with a lesson I have travelled to then that is also chargeable at the full rate. Should the weather be such that we mutually agree that it would be unsafe or unproductive to go ahead then no charge will apply. This will only apply up to an hour before the scheduled lesson time. It only takes a minute to stop raining!
I try to be fair both with my pricing and with the time I offer both during the lesson and after should anyone need help or advice. In return I ask that my time is respected and if a cancellation is necessary I am given adequate notice to enable me to fill the slot.
